Superresolution Reconstruction of Multispectral Data for Improved Image Classification
Abstract
In this letter, the application of superresolution (SR) techniques to multispectral image clustering and classification is investigated and tested using satellite data. A set of multispectral images with better spatial resolution is obtained after an SR technique is applied to several data sets recorded within a short period over a study area.
